Daft I S B N - 13 : 9789814922791 I S B N - 10 : 981492279x 類 別: 組織理論 版 次: 13 版 年 份: 2021 規 格: 730 頁 出 版 商: Cengage Learning 簡介 Introduce your students to the most progressive thinking about organizations today as acclaimed author Richard Daft balances recent, innovative ideas with proven classic theories and effective business practices. Daft's best-selling ORGANIZATION THEORY AND DESIGN presents a captivating, compelling snapshot of contemporary organizations and the concepts driving their success. Recognized as one of the most systematic, well-organized texts in the market, the 13th edition of ORGANIZATION THEORY AND DESIGN helps current and future managers prepare for the challenges of today's business world. Students see how many of today's well-known organizations have learned to cope and even thrive amidst a rapidly changing, highly competitive international environment. Organization studies, proven cases, and illustrations provide the insights necessary to better understand modern organizations, while new and proven learning features give your students opportunities to apply concepts and refine their personal business skills and insights. 目錄 PART I: INTRODUCTION TO ORGANIZATIONS Ch 1 Organizations and Organization Design PART II: ORGANIZATION PURPOSE AND STRUCTURAL DESIGN Ch 2 Strategy, Organization Design, and Effectiveness Ch 3 Fundamentals of Organization Structure PART III: OPEN SYSTEM DESIGN ELEMENTS Ch 4 The External Environment Ch 5 Interorganizational Relationships Ch 6 Designing Organizations for the International Environment Ch 7 Designs for Societal Impact: Dual-Purpose Organizations, Corporate Sustainability, and Ethics PART IV: INTERNAL DESIGN ELEMENTS Ch 8 Designs for Manufacturing and Service Technologies Ch 9 Designs for Digital Organizations and Big Data Analytics Ch10 Organization Size, Life Cycle, and Dec PART V: MANAGING DYNAMIC PROCESSES Ch11 Organizational Culture and Control Ch12 Innovation and Change Ch13 Decision-Making Processes Ch14 Conflict, Power, and Politics
